Hoffman's relationship with Ashley should raise a few eyebrows - bet there are more than a few PL clubs looking at this development with a lot of interest.
Hoffman was the one who pushed through the Saudi Newcastle deal against the wishes of many PL clubs (informed them after deal was done and without consultation) and it cost him that job.
12 months later he's going to be on the board of a new Ashley business.

It does seem that terms same as those they're on were offered pre-sale and not signed. But right now mirrored terms are NOT on the table. They've been withdrawn for a much shorter term.

The entire thing has got me thinking about why has everyone in this mess has done what they have.

My guess is that by signing the mirrored terms pre-sale SISU/King would have effectively scuppered their own bid for the stadium. So did Fraser's only offer the terms because they expected them to be turned down and thus allow them to state they offered the same terms but they were refused?

Then it's when did Fraser's remove those mirrored terms for the six month deal? Was it as soon as the deal went through? Was it when CCFC said they wanted changes in a new agreement?

Seems like crap decisions all round. MA doesn't care what people think of him but even so serving an eviction notice on a local football club where you want to base the HQ of one of your businesses seems like an incredibly stupid thing to do. It may well help him get the club cheaper but mainly because he's driven the price down and made the club and fans suffer in the process. He'd have to invest the money he saves back in just to bring us back up to the same level of competitiveness we are now. So swings and roundabouts just so he can feel like he's got one over someone. Only he's not factoring in how stubborn Seppala can be.

Ok, but my understanding is if we were leaseholders (sublease) our landlord would need our agreement to even enter the arena. That could affect all sort of things H of F might want to do, from concerts to allowing Wasps to play there.
If that is the case, from their pov a sublease to us makes no commercial sense.
Not sure I'm right of this, just trying to assimilate what I have read about leases v licences.
